Rapper, Money Is The Motto

With Atlanta's dominance in urban music being evident on virtually every countdown, it's only appropriate that one of the newest talents to come out of Atlanta would also use the music Mecca as his stage name. Born Thomas Alejandro Westmoreland, the 20-year -old Atlanta native whose mother gave him the moniker ATL, is ready to show the world that there's more to ATL than what they might have seen in the movie.

"I'm a lyricist and an artist. I use words. When I use words, I use real-life experiences. That separates me from a lot of dudes. I just keep my music [more] real than what they're talking about and I'm just living my [life] and putting it on [a] CD," says ATL. With his first mixtape, Money Is The Motto, which was released independently on his label Red Eyes, Inc. - already raising eyebrows, collaborations with Grand Hustle artists suggest that ATL will be the next big thing to come from the South.

"I feel like there's a million artists and for you to outshine and be that next one, you've just got to be honest with yourself [and ask], 'am I willing to do this?' " he says. "I've already been ready, so it's just to a point [of] when the streets will be ready." ATL plans to follow up Money Is The Motto with Executive Suite. -jason thompson
